Skip to content

Commit 95ab2ff

Browse files
committed
refactor: move AspectWatchProtocol to standalone library
1 parent 85eedb8 commit 95ab2ff

File tree

19 files changed

+2537
-1792
lines changed

19 files changed

+2537
-1792
lines changed

.aspect/rules/external_repository_action_cache/npm_translate_lock_LTE4Nzc1MDcwNjU=

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-21,16 +21,16 @@ examples/npm_package/packages/pkg_e/package.json=-2145239245
2121
examples/runfiles/package.json=-1545884645
2222
examples/stack_traces/package.json=2011229626
2323
examples/webpack_cli/package.json=1911342006
24-
js/private/coverage/bundle/package.json=-1582937149
24+
js/private/coverage/bundle/package.json=-1439711711
2525
js/private/test/image/package.json=1430754959
2626
js/private/test/js_run_devserver/package.json=-459994543
27-
js/private/worker/src/package.json=251852959
27+
js/private/worker/src/package.json=208226706
2828
npm/private/test/npm_package/package.json=-1991705133
2929
npm/private/test/npm_package_publish/package.json=-646566766
3030
npm/private/test/package.json=322962683
3131
npm/private/test/vendored/is-odd/package.json=1041695223
3232
npm/private/test/vendored/lodash-4.17.21.tgz=-1206623349
3333
npm/private/test/vendored/semver-max/package.json=578664053
34-
package.json=1068891966
35-
pnpm-lock.yaml=1499299525
36-
pnpm-workspace.yaml=854106668
34+
package.json=-1285076633
35+
pnpm-lock.yaml=596103636
36+
pnpm-workspace.yaml=963388207

.bazelignore

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-27,6 +27,7 @@ js/private/test/image/node_modules
2727
js/private/test/js_run_devserver/node_modules
2828
js/private/worker/src/node_modules
2929
node_modules/
30+
npm/private/src/node_modules/
3031
npm/private/test/node_modules/
3132
npm/private/test/npm_package/node_modules/
3233
npm/private/test/npm_package_publish/node_modules

.gitattributes

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-4,3 +4,4 @@ e2e/rules_foo/npm_repositories.bzl linguist-generated=true
44
**/snapshots/** linguist-generated=true
55
js/private/coverage/coverage.js linguist-generated=true
66
js/private/js_image_layer.mjs linguist-generated=true
7+
js/private/js_run_devserver.mjs linguist-generated=true

.prettierignore

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,7 @@ docs/*_*.md
33
docs/nextjs.md
44
e2e/**/*-docs.md
55
examples/**/*-docs.md
6+
js/private/js_run_devserver.mjs
67
js/private/coverage/coverage.js
78
js/private/node-patches/fs.cjs
89
min/

js/private/BUILD.bazel

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-2,6 +2,7 @@
22

33
load("@aspect_bazel_lib//lib:copy_to_bin.bzl", "copy_to_bin")
44
load("@aspect_bazel_lib//lib:utils.bzl", bazel_lib_utils = "utils")
5+
load("@aspect_bazel_lib//lib:write_source_files.bzl", "write_source_files")
56
load("@bazel_skylib//:bzl_library.bzl", "bzl_library")
67

78
package(default_visibility = ["//visibility:public"])
@@ -109,3 +110,10 @@ copy_to_bin(
109110
name = "js_devserver_entrypoint",
110111
srcs = ["js_run_devserver.mjs"],
111112
)
113+
114+
write_source_files(
115+
name = "devserver_checked",
116+
files = {
117+
"js_run_devserver.mjs": "//js/private/src:js_run_devserver.mjs",
118+
},
119+
)

js/private/coverage/bundle/BUILD.bazel

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
load("@npm//:defs.bzl", "npm_link_all_packages")
2-
load("@npm//js/private/coverage/bundle:rollup/package_json.bzl", rollup_bin = "bin")
2+
load("@npm//:rollup/package_json.bzl", rollup_bin = "bin")
33

44
npm_link_all_packages(name = "node_modules")
55

@@ -9,10 +9,10 @@ rollup_bin.rollup(
99
"c8.js",
1010
"package.json",
1111
"rollup.config.mjs",
12-
":node_modules/@rollup/plugin-commonjs",
13-
":node_modules/@rollup/plugin-json",
14-
":node_modules/@rollup/plugin-node-resolve",
1512
":node_modules/c8",
13+
"//:node_modules/@rollup/plugin-commonjs",
14+
"//:node_modules/@rollup/plugin-json",
15+
"//:node_modules/@rollup/plugin-node-resolve",
1616
],
1717
outs = [
1818
"bundle.js",

js/private/coverage/bundle/package.json

Lines changed: 0 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-2,11 +2,5 @@
22
"type": "module",
33
"dependencies": {
44
"c8": "10.1.3"
5-
},
6-
"devDependencies": {
7-
"@rollup/plugin-commonjs": "28.0.3",
8-
"@rollup/plugin-json": "6.1.0",
9-
"@rollup/plugin-node-resolve": "16.0.1",
10-
"rollup": "4.39.0"
115
}
126
}

0 commit comments

Comments
 (0)